From Dance to Dining: Explore Local Favorites at Woodbridge Village Center

Woodbridge Village Center is home to a variety of locally owned businesses that bring creativity, learning, and community to Irvine. From dance and music lessons to family shopping and chef-inspired dining, these small businesses have become favorite destinations for residents of all ages.
Focus Dance Center โ For more than 20 years, Focus Dance Center has offered dance classes for children and adults in styles ranging from ballet and jazz to hip-hop and K-pop.
Dancing Keys Music Studio โ Opened in 2013, Dancing Keys Music Studio teaches piano using the Simply Music method, helping students develop a lifelong love of music by learning to play before focusing on reading sheet music.
Sessions West Coast Deli โ Since 2018, Sessions has served chef-inspired sandwiches. The locally owned deli has become a popular neighborhood gathering spot in Woodbridge.
Hide & Squeak Kids โ This family-focused boutique offers children's clothing, toys, accessories.

UCI Health Shares What to Know About the Rise in Cyclosporiasis

A gastrointestinal illness called cyclosporiasis is becoming more common across the U.S. this summer, according to UCI Health. The infection can cause watery diarrhea, nausea, vomiting, stomach cramps, bloating, and dehydration, with symptoms that may last or return over several weeks. UCI Health infectious disease expert Dr. Shruti Gohil says the illness can be confirmed with a stool test and is typically treated successfully with a commonly available antibiotic. If symptoms are persistent or severe, it's a good idea to consult a healthcare provider.

Dry Cat Food and Kidney Health: Helpful Information for Cat Owners

Choosing the right food for your cat can feel overwhelming with so much information available online. Veterinary experts share that dry cat food is not a direct cause of kidney or urinary problems, but making sure your cat stays well hydrated is an important part of supporting their overall health.
Dry cat food from reputable manufacturers does not directly cause kidney or urinary tract disease.
Because cats naturally don't drink much water, the extra moisture in wet food may help support bladder and kidney health.
Cats that are already prone to urinary or kidney issues may benefit from additional hydration.
If your cat prefers dry food, your veterinarian may recommend urinary-support formulas, adding water to kibble, or using a pet water fountain to encourage drinking.
Regular annual blood work and urine testing can help monitor kidney health and detect changes early.
Cats with kidney disease may benefit from a veterinarian-recommended kidney-support diet, whether wet or dry, depending on what they will eat consistently.
If you have questions about your cat's diet, your veterinarian can help recommend a nutrition plan that's best suited to your cat's individual needs.

UC Irvine Men's Basketball Welcome Big West Standout Nils Cooper to 2026โ27 Roster

UC Irvine men's basketball has added transfer Nils Cooper from UC Davis for the 2026โ27 season. The 6-foot-6 wing averaged 12.3 points and 4.6 rebounds last season, earned Academic All-District honors, and brings Big West experience to the Anteaters.
